Walking pads, also known as treadmills under the desk are compact devices that offer a great method of exercising low-impact while working. This easy addition to your office could help you avoid stiff joints and boost productivity by enhancing blood circulation.

Many models fold up and can be tucked away under your desk. They also have wheels that help them move. This allows you move around the room, and to fold away the pad when it is not in use.

Prevent joint stiffness

Many people experience stiff joints, particularly at the beginning of the day. This is often caused by the lack of lubrication within the joint spaces or the breakdown of cartilage that protects the bones' ends. The pain usually lasts for a short time and will subside when the person begins to move again. However, some people have persistent or ongoing joint stiffness that may be due to an underlying health issue.

A low-impact exercise such as walking is a great method to reduce stiff joints by boosting the strength of your muscles and lubrication within joints. It also helps people maintain a healthy weight which can reduce joint stress. A medical professional, such as a physical therapist could assist in creating an exercise program that is specific to the specific needs of the individual.

Begin to warm up your body for a short time by performing range-of motion exercises. Slowly increase your pace until you reach a fast one. Listen to your body. Stop if you notice a sharp or sharp pain. A little soreness is acceptable after exercise However, if the pain persists, it's a good idea seek out your doctor.

A balanced, healthy diet that is rich in fiber, whole grains and vegetables, fruits, healthy oils, probiotics, and spices can help lower the chance of having stiff joints. Additionally, having a proper routine for sleeping is crucial to prevent joint pain. It is recommended to to sleep in the same way each night and rise at the same time each day.

Osteoarthritis and rheumatoidarthritis as well bursitis are all causes of stiff joints. However, with the right treatment, home remedies and lifestyle adjustments, the majority of people are able to relieve joint stiffness. If you are experiencing persistent or extreme stiffness in your joints, it is essential to see a doctor to determine if there are any underlying issues.
